I stalked my husband for two years before he ever truly met me.
‎He thinks we met through his younger brother by coincidence. He believes fate put us in the same house, in the same city, in each other’s arms.

‎But the truth? I built that fate.

‎I was fourteen when I first saw him, eighteen, charming, and already etched into my dreams. What started as a crush turned into obsession. I befriended his brother, charmed his mother, studied his habits, memorized his world.

‎For ten years, I orchestrated every moment that led us to love and marriage.

‎Now, years later, I sit beside him every night as his wife, bearing a truth he doesn’t know:
‎He fell in love with the version of me I built for him.

‎But secrets are heavy, and guilt grows louder.

‎When I finally confess, everything spirals, love, loyalty, identity, and the line between affection and manipulation.
‎He always said I was his destiny.
‎But what if I was just his design?

‎A romantic, emotional psychological drama about love, obsession, and whether the truth can survive after the perfect lie.
